Ticket #—: Vault locked, tide-table widget release blocked

Severity: medium. The Saltmere tide-table widget can't ship — its signing material sits in the Copperline vault, which auto-locked after three failed unseal attempts during last night's maintenance. No evidence of intrusion; audit log shows the attempts came from the scheduled rotation job with an expired token. Requesting security review sign-off to manually unseal. Widget itself is fine; only packaging is blocked. Once approved, unseal Copperline using the recovery passphrase below:

strongbox words: zormir-quenath-sorax

## Crashwell Pipeline — Environments

Crashwell ingests crash reports from the Lumabird mobile apps in three environments: dev, staging, and prod. Each environment has its own ingestion endpoint and retention policy; prod retains symbolicated reports for 90 days. Access to prod is restricted to the Telemetry team at Fernhollow. The staging environment uses the following configuration values.

settings of yageg-yahap:
[gorael]
team = olieth
access_code = ac_941d74
owner = brieth.aldiel
host = gorael.tolvaqio.internal
port = 6379
peer = briwyn.urlaqtech.internal
salt = 116e6622
pin = 1957

Hey folks — quick handoff note on the Orpheum Lane seat-map renderer. The SVG layer now caches zone geometry, so reloads are way faster, but clear the cache whenever the venue config changes or seats will drift. Staging is wired up and ready for your integration tests. To hit the staging API, use the bearer token below.

session JWT of yawep-yawep = eyJhbGciOiJIUzI1NiIsInR5cCI6IkpXVCJ9.eyJzdWIiOiI3pWF3_In0.aXYsHiog

### Handover — Paritywatch

Hey — passing Paritywatch over before I rotate off. It scrapes rate quotes for the Bellhaven hotel group and flags mismatches across channels. Security-wise, the crawler credentials rotate weekly via the vault job; if that job fails, scraping silently degrades, so watch the alert. The parser sandbox hasn't been re-audited since the Q2 changes — worth flagging in your review. Threat model doc is in the team wiki, slightly stale. Ongoing ownership and audit questions go to the engineer named below.

approver of bagug-bagag = Holael Pramir